Inode of Ext2 or Ext3 format must be 128
In ubuntu open a terminal and type
To see the DCP usb stick path
- Code: Select all
$ lsblk
then you need to unmount the usb stick that you want to format
(considering that the path of the stick is /dev/sde1)
- Code: Select all
$ sudo umount /dev/sde1
then format the stick, it can take a long time, when the format is done eject the key and reintroduce it
- Code: Select all
$ sudo mkfs.ext2 -I 128 0 -L DCPSTICKNAME /dev/sde1
Then you need to modify authorizations and ownership of the stick
- Code: Select all
$ sudo chmod 777 -R /media/UBUNTUUSER/DCPSTICKNAME
and
- Code: Select all
$ sudo chown R root:root /media/UBUNTUUSER/DCPSTICKNAME
after that copy your DCP in the USB stick and eject safely.
